Laminar free convective heat transfer from isothermal vertical slender cylinder
چکیده انگلیسی

An experimental study of the laminar free convective average heat transfer in air from isothermal vertical slender cylinder having circular cross-section was performed using a transient technique. These results obtained for Prandtl number Pr = 0.71 in the range of Rayleigh number 1.5 × 108 < RaH < 1.1 × 109 and dimensionless height of 0 < H/D < 60 are correlated with the equationNuH=ARaHnwhere A = 0.519 + 0.03454(H/D) + 0.0008772(H/D)2 + 8.855 × 10−6(H/D)3 and n = 0.25–0.00253 (H/D) + 1.152 × 10−5 (H/D)2 agree well with the known numerical data which are approximated with the equation NuH/NuH−FP = f(GrH, H/D) valid in laminar boundary layer region (GrH-crit ⩽ 4 × 109) for fluids of Prandtl number within 0.01 < Pr < 100 and for the transverse curvature parameter ξ=32GrH0.25HD<5. Besides the slenderness criterion determining situation when the vertical isothermal cylinder of circular cross-section cannot be treated as a flat plate is presented in the form GrH0.25DH⩽f(Pr).
